Pattaya Massage


 

Rub a dub dub.
If you have not tried a Thai Massage, you have not lived. Massage is an ancient tradition in Thailand and is enjoyed by all and performed by many. Even that girl you met yesterday at a Beer Bar will probably offer a little massage to get you relaxed.

Pattaya MassageHere in Pattaya, the choices are truly limitless. Traditional massage, which usually (but not always) means no hanky panky, is practiced in shops the length and breadth of Pattaya. Foot massage has enjoyed growing popularity and as you walk the streets of Pattaya you will see many foreigners lying on a bed in a shop window having their feet dealt to. Be careful because this can be an addictive experience. Traditional massage usually takes place with little privacy on a narrow bed. Most operators can do 5 or 6 people at one time, and will have a thin curtain strung up between the beds. Usual price is around 500 baht for 90 minutes.
